Common Door Problems

Homeowners regularly experience a variety of door-related issues. Understanding these problems enables effective repairs and maintenance. Here are a few of the most common door issues:

Door Problem Description
Sticking Door A door that does not open or close efficiently.
Squeaky Hinge A loud sound when opening or closing the door.
Loose Handle A handle that wobbles or doesn’t engage the latch properly.
Malfunctioning Lock A lock that does not turn or is stuck.
Cracked or Damaged Frame A door frame that shows indications of wear, splitting, or warping.

Step-by-Step Door Repair Techniques

3.1 Fixing a Sticking Door

A sticking door can be a discouraging issue, typically brought on by humidity or misalignment. Here’s how to fix it:

  1. Identify the Problem Area: Open and close the door to locate where it sticks.
  2. Check for Alignment: Use a level to see if the door is set properly in the frame.
  3. Change Hinges:
    • For misaligned hinges, tighten up screws or shim the hinges.
  4. Sand the Problem Area: Use sandpaper to smooth the edges of the door where it sticks.
  5. Check the Door: Open and close the door to ensure it moves easily.

3.2 Repairing a Door Hinge

Squeaky or loose hinges can be easily repaired. The list below actions lay out how to address this issue:

  1. Remove the Hinge Pin: Use a screwdriver or hammer to carefully tap out the hinge pin.
  2. Clean and Lubricate: Wipe the pin and hinge with a fabric and use lubricant (such as WD-40).
  3. Reinsert the Hinge Pin: Place the hinge pin back into the hinge.
  4. Evaluate the Hinge: Open and close the door to confirm the squeak is gone.

3.3 Replacing a Door Handle

Replacing a broken door handle can improve security and functionality. Here’s how to change it:

  1. Remove the Old Handle:
    • Unscrew the handle from both sides of the door.
    • Eliminate the latch mechanism and keep the screws.
  2. Set Up the New Handle:
    • Insert the brand-new lock and secure it with screws.
    • Connect the new handle to both sides of the door.
  3. Test the Handle: Ensure the deal with operates efficiently and the door opens and closes safely.

3.4 Fixing a Door Lock

A malfunctioning door lock can endanger security. Follow these actions to fix a lock:

  1. Assess the Lock: Determine if the concern is with the key, the lock cylinder, or the lock.
  2. Lube the Lock: Apply graphite lubricator to the keyhole for smooth operation.
  3. Inspect the Alignment: Verify that the strike plate lines up with the latch; adjust if needed.
  4. Replace the Lock: If it’s beyond repair, follow the maker’s guidelines to install a new lock.

Preventive Measures

Regular maintenance can extend the life of doors and prevent pricey repairs. Here are some preventive steps to remember:

  • Regular Inspection: Check doors for indications of wear, damage, or misalignment.
  • Lube Hinges: Keep door hardware lubricated to decrease friction and wear.
  • Seal Gaps: Use weather condition stripping to prevent air leak and secure versus moisture.
  • Enhance Security: Regularly check locks and handles for optimum security functionality.

Regularly Asked Questions

Q1: How typically should I maintain my doors?

A1: It’s advisable to inspect and preserve doors at least as soon as a year to capture any potential issues early.

Q2: Can I repair a door myself, or should I employ a professional?

A2: Many door repairs can be done by house owners with the right tools and guidelines. For intricate issues, employing a professional is advised.

Q3: What’s the best lubricant for door hinges?

A3: Graphite lubricants are highly advised, as they are non-greasy and will not gather dirt. However, silicone sprays can likewise be effective.

Q4: What should I do if my door won’t lock?

A4: Check the alignment of the latch and strike plate. If essential, lubricate the lock mechanism or think about changing the lock.

Q5: Can weather modifications impact my door’s performance?

A5: Yes, humidity and temperature level changes can cause wood doors to broaden or agreement, resulting in sticking or misalignment. Routine change and maintenance can mitigate these results.
